Unix包管理精要:构建数据科学环境的基石

在数据科学领域,构建一个稳定、可重复的环境是成功的关键。Unix系统以其强大的包管理工具,成为许多数据科学家的首选平台。

Unix包管理的核心在于其分类清晰、依赖关系明确的特点。通过使用如APT(Debian/Ubuntu)、YUM/DNF(Red Hat/CentOS)或Homebrew(macOS)等工具,用户可以高效地安装、更新和管理软件包。

选择合适的包管理器能够显著提升开发效率。例如,Homebrew在macOS上提供了简单易用的接口,而APT则在Linux环境中广泛用于处理复杂的依赖关系。

数据科学工作流通常涉及Python、R、Jupyter Notebook等工具,这些都可以通过包管理器快速部署。同时,版本控制和虚拟环境的支持使得不同项目之间的依赖冲突得以避免。

本图基于AI算法,仅供参考

包管理不仅限于安装软件,还支持配置文件的管理与系统服务的维护,这为构建自动化、可扩展的数据科学环境提供了坚实基础。

熟悉包管理的最佳实践,如定期清理缓存、保持系统更新,有助于维持系统的健康状态,从而保障数据科学工作的连续性和稳定性。

dawei

【声明】:绥化站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复